299744b78faf63cf576110a19d86179d35f5645b41a66d02e031af562ec38cca

1714924 (5325 blocks ago)

⏴ Block 1714923 (1a0a2915...f50) | Block 1714925 ⏵ | Latest block ⏭

Metadata

11/11/24, 12:10 pm UTC (7d 9:31:55 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details